
Sen. Ron Wyden on the Secret Republican Health Care Bill
Secrecy, evasion, and stonewalling defined the news in Congress this week. While the media focused on Attorney General Jeff Sessions’s tight-lipped testimony before the Senate Intelligence Committee on Tuesday, a more consequential story hid in the deep recesses of congressional boardrooms, as Senate Republicans furtively crafted their replacement for Obamacare.
No doubt this secrecy was part of the reason why the New York Times, Washington Post, LA Times, and the Wall Street Journal failed to cover it on their front pages for much of the week. Brooke speaks with Democratic Senator Ron Wyden of Oregon about the great lengths Republicans have gone to hide their bill from the press and Senate Democrats, and what it could mean for millions of Americans.
